How many months a year is the best time to take a calcium supplement?

Calcium supplementation is not based on how many months of the year it is taken, but is determined by the normalization of calcium levels in the body and the presence of adverse reactions. Calcium supplementation is intended for use in the prevention and treatment of calcium deficiencies such as osteoporosis, tetany, osteogenesis imperfecta, rickets, as well as calcium supplementation for children, pregnant and lactating women, menopausal women, and the elderly. Calcium supplementation should be stopped or prohibited if hypercalcemia or hypercalciuria occurs. In the process of calcium supplementation, attention should be paid to whether there are adverse reactions, such as: constipation, kidney stones, ureteral stones, bladder stones, etc. If hypercalcemia and stone disease occur, it is necessary to discontinue or use with caution. Healthy people can take calcium supplements through food. Foods with high calcium content, such as milk, soy products, etc., but also more exercise, more sunshine, to promote the absorption of calcium, if you need to take calcium drugs should be applied under the guidance of a doctor.
